Output 521b611728de082523bc8e1727dd0c134c22046024a4bba96fa43103c17e889d:1

value
79232000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c86441115dba35c2f4df658ec75ffcea894c75c OP_EQUAL
address
3Mo3RhmcHBMXQnEQbq24T69cYjbYhT5Ac8
transaction
521b611728de082523bc8e1727dd0c134c22046024a4bba96fa43103c17e889d
spent
true